@media all and (min-width:768px){.et_pb_scroll_top.et-pb-icon{display:none!important}}@media (min-width:981px) and (max-width:1180px){#main-header .container{width:96%!important}#main-header #logo{max-height:52px!important;width:auto!important}#logo{max-width:240px!important}#top-menu>li{padding-right:10px!important}#top-menu>li>a{font-size:25px!important;line-height:1.1!important}#top-menu li.menu-cta>a,#top-menu li.menu_button>a,#top-menu li.button>a{padding:7px 12px!important;border-width:2px!important;font-size:13px!important;white-space:nowrap!important;line-height:1!important}}